What is an associate software development engineer in test?

An Associate Software Development Engineer in Test (SDET) is an entry-level professional who designs, develops, and maintains automated tests to ensure the quality and functionality of software applications. They work closely with software developers and quality assurance teams to identify bugs, create test scripts, and automate testing processes. Their primary focus is on improving software reliability and streamlining the testing workflow by using programming skills to build robust test frameworks. This role often serves as a stepping stone to more advanced positions in quality engineering or software development.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an associate software development engineer in test?

To thrive as an Associate Software Development Engineer In Test, you need a solid understanding of programming languages (such as Java, Python, or JavaScript), software testing principles, and a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with automated testing frameworks (like Selenium or JUnit), version control systems (such as Git), and CI/CD tools is typically required.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help you collaborate with development teams and identify issues efficiently. These skills and qualities are critical for ensuring software quality, reducing defects, and supporting the agile development process.

What are some typical challenges faced by an associate software development engineer in test when collaborating with development teams?

As an Associate SDET, one common challenge is ensuring clear communication between QA and development teams, especially when clarifying requirements or reporting bugs. SDETs often need to advocate for quality while balancing release deadlines, which requires effective collaboration and negotiation skills. Additionally, integrating automated tests into fast-paced development cycles can be complex, especially when dealing with evolving codebases or shifting priorities. Overcoming these challenges involves proactive communication, continuous learning, and adaptability within agile team structures.

What is the difference between Associate Software Development Engineer In Test vs Software Development Engineer In Test?

AspectAssociate Software Development Engineer In TestSoftware Development Engineer In Test
QualificationsBachelor's in CS or related field, some experienceBachelor's or higher in CS, more experience often required
Work EnvironmentEntry-level, collaborative teams, learning-focusedMore autonomous, complex testing tasks, leadership roles
ResponsibilitiesWriting basic test scripts, executing tests, learning automation toolsDesigning test frameworks, automating tests, improving testing processes

The main difference is experience level and scope. Associate Software Development Engineer In Test roles are entry-level, focusing on learning and executing tests, while Software Development Engineer In Test positions involve more complex automation and design responsibilities, often requiring more experience.

Overview
This role involves supporting and enhancing AML platforms, payments screening systems, and enterprise data pipelines within a risk mitigation and financial crime environment. The position requires a highly technical, data-intensive approach with a focus on automation, testing strategy, and domain knowledge in AML and financial crime technology.

Key Responsibilities

  • Own testing for AML platforms including Actimize and FircoSoft. Define test approach, scope, and entry/exit criteria for assigned work. Identify quality risks and escalate proactively.
  • Design, build, and maintain automated UI and API tests. Improve automation coverage and reduce manual regression effort. Troubleshoot automation failures and environmental issues.
  • Guide and mentor junior QA engineers. Review test cases and automation code for quality and effectiveness. Promote best practices in testing and defect prevention.
  • Ensure automated tests are reliably executed in CI pipelines. Provide clear quality status, metrics, and risk assessments to stakeholders.
  • Apply domain knowledge to design meaningful test scenarios. Ensure testing covers real-world usage and regulatory considerations.
  • Testing of RESTful and SOAP services, including contract validation and negative scenarios. Implement and promote service virtualization and test stubbing strategies to enable parallel development and early testing.
  • Validate data integrity across systems. Analyze database impacts and downstream effects of application changes.
